The short answer to the question is: Yes, the Pumpkin Moon can be summoned in a pre-Hardmode world, but there’s a significant caveat. While you can technically initiate the event, it is not intended to be a pre-Hardmode activity and will likely be a very challenging and potentially fruitless endeavor. Let’s delve deeper into the mechanics and the implications.
Understanding the Pumpkin Moon Mechanics
The Pumpkin Moon is a Hardmode event, designed as a considerable challenge for players who have already progressed into the mid-to-late stages of Hardmode. This is clearly indicated by the required summoning item: the Pumpkin Moon Medallion. This medallion requires specific crafting ingredients that are only obtainable in Hardmode, specifically from enemies that spawn after defeating Plantera.
The Paradox of Pre-Hardmode Summoning
The paradox arises because the game allows the use of the Pumpkin Moon Medallion even in pre-Hardmode worlds, provided the player can obtain it. This is usually done by a player who is in Hardmode who creates the item and brings it to a player in a pre-Hardmode world via multiplayer. This means a player can technically use the item at night and attempt to initiate the event in a pre-Hardmode world.
Why It’s Not Recommended
While technically possible, summoning the Pumpkin Moon pre-Hardmode is generally a bad idea, for several reasons:
- Extreme Difficulty: The event is designed for players with Hardmode gear and weapons. Enemies are significantly stronger than those found in pre-Hardmode, making survival highly unlikely.
- Limited Progression: The rewards from the Pumpkin Moon, while valuable, are primarily designed to aid further progression in Hardmode. Pre-Hardmode players will find most of this loot to be either unusable or ineffective.
- Resource Waste: The Pumpkin Moon Medallion is a valuable resource. Using it on a pre-Hardmode world is generally a waste, as it’s highly unlikely you’ll be able to survive, let alone make any meaningful progress.
- The Pumpkin Moon Medallion is crafted using Ectoplasm. Ectoplasm drops from Dungeon Spirits who only spawn after Plantera is defeated. In this case, it could only be obtained via external means.
In essence, while the game allows it, the developers clearly designed the event to be tackled after Plantera, within the scope of the game’s intended progression. Summoning it beforehand will likely result in a quick and frustrating defeat.

What is the Pumpkin Moon?
The Pumpkin Moon is a Hardmode, post-Plantera event in Terraria. It is a wave-based event, with progressively more challenging enemies, including several unique mini-bosses. The event lasts from dusk until dawn (4:30 AM).
How do you summon the Pumpkin Moon?
You summon the Pumpkin Moon by using the Pumpkin Moon Medallion at night. It cannot be summoned during the day, and attempting to use the item at day will not consume it.
What items are required to craft a Pumpkin Moon Medallion?
The Pumpkin Moon Medallion requires:
- 5 Ectoplasm (dropped by Dungeon Spirits in the Hardmode Dungeon after Plantera is defeated)
- 10 Hallowed Bars (crafted from Hallowed Ore, which spawns in Hardmode)
- 30 Pumpkin (grown from Pumpkin seeds, or found during Halloween)
When can you summon the Pumpkin Moon?
The Pumpkin Moon can be summoned at any time of the year as long as it’s nighttime and you have the Pumpkin Moon Medallion. It’s not tied to the actual Halloween season.

How long does the Pumpkin Moon event last?
The Pumpkin Moon event always ends at dawn (4:30 AM), regardless of how far you have progressed through the waves.
How many waves are in the Pumpkin Moon event?
The Pumpkin Moon event consists of 15 waves, each increasing in difficulty. In the first waves, you’ll see many weaker enemies. In the final waves, numerous bosses will be swarming you.
